WebNov 22, 2024 · 4. The Temperature of the Water. If you’re swimming in cold water, your body is working harder to stay warm. This can cause a minimal level of muscle strain, which can leave you feeling tired after a few laps around an outdoor pool. The ideal temperature for swimming is around 79 degrees Fahrenheit. 5. WebSwimming definition, the act of a person or thing that swims. See more. WebJul 1, 2024 · Wearing ear plugs should stop water getting in and causing the pressure change. As a result, it can reduce the chances of feeling ill. Follow the package instructions with ear plugs and never push them deep into your ear canal. Other things that can influence nausea when swimming are your levels of hydration and food intake.

WebSwimming in water that is too warm -- over 90 degrees Fahrenheit -- can lead to overheating and exhaustion -- particularly when you are exerting yourself by swimming several laps or a marathon. Warm water increases your body temperature, which also raises your sweat rate and quickens dehydration. Your body tries to cool itself down through ...
